Your lead arm points where you want the board to go, and your back arm bends to roughly 90 degrees to keep you balanced. That’s the whole cue. Look at the spot on the wave you want to reach, extend your front arm toward it, and let your hips and shoulders follow naturally.

Try this on your very next wave:

  • Eyes first: find your target down the line before you even pop up.
  • Lead arm second: point it at that target and let it stay there through the turn.
  • Hips third: let your shoulders and hips rotate to match where the arm is already pointing.

Keep your shoulders loose, not locked. And if you fall, get your hands up near your head as you surface. Boards and fins don’t wait for beginners to find their footing.

Surf Arm Positioning Explained for Beginners: The Biomechanics

Your arms aren’t decoration. They’re steering input, and the board reads them constantly.

When you extend your lead arm toward where you want to go, you create rotational torque that starts in your shoulders and travels down through your hips into the board’s rail. This isn’t a metaphor. Turning a surfboard works the same way turning your body works on land: shoulders rotate, hips follow, and whatever is underneath you (skis, a bike, a board) tracks that rotation. Surf Science’s coaching guidance on lead-arm pointing confirms what most instructors already tell beginners on day one: the board goes where your body tells it to go, and your arm is the clearest signal you can send.

Looking where you want to go matters just as much as the arm itself, and the two reinforce each other. Your head turns, your torso follows, your arm extends toward the same point, and suddenly you’ve got three body parts agreeing on one direction instead of fighting each other.

Ignore your arms and you’ll notice the same three problems over and over. Turns happen too late because your body had no early signal to rotate. Balance gets shaky because your arms are flailing for stability instead of contributing to it. And worst of all, you over-rotate. Without a lead arm holding a fixed point, your shoulders keep spinning past where you meant to stop, and you end up sideways or in the water. Arm position isn’t a finishing touch you add once the basics click. It’s one of the basics.

Where to Put Your Leading Arm and How to Practice It

Your leading arm sits out in front of you, roughly in line with your front foot, pointed toward wherever the wave lets you go next. Not down at the water. Not tucked against your chest. Extended, with a slight bend at the elbow, aimed at your target the way a boxer’s jab aims at a spot rather than a general direction.

The mechanics are simple once you isolate them. As you pop up, your lead hand should already be reaching toward the direction you plan to ride. If you’re going right, that arm extends right and slightly forward. If you’re cutting back toward the whitewater, it points there instead. The arm leads. The board catches up.

Three drills build this fast, and none require water:

  1. Exaggerated pointing on land. Stand in a surf stance on the sand or your living room floor. Pick a target, point your lead arm at it like you’re aiming a rifle, and rotate your hips and shoulders to match. Hold for three seconds. Repeat 15 to 20 times, switching targets each round.
  2. Target vision drills. Before you even touch the board, practice scanning a room or beach, picking a fixed point, and snapping your eyes and arm to it simultaneously. This trains the eye-arm link that Surf Science identifies as the fastest way to simplify the whole motor pattern, since beginners often treat their arms as separate from the rest of the body instead of an extension of it.
  3. Pop-up with lead-arm focus. On the board (land or water), pop up in three phases: hands push, feet land, lead arm extends toward your chosen line. Do this slowly at first. Speed comes later.

Progression matters more than most beginners realize. Start in small whitewater where the wave energy is forgiving and mistakes don’t cost you much. Once the pointing motion feels automatic there, move to larger green waves where the stakes for bad timing go up. Breakthrough Surf School’s coaching approach backs this up directly: exaggerate the movement early to build the correct neuromuscular pattern, then dial it back to something more natural as the motion becomes second nature.

Pro Tip: Pick a physical landmark on shore, like a lifeguard tower or a distinct rock, before you paddle out. Point your lead arm at that exact object during every practice wave. A fixed reference point trains your brain faster than a vague “somewhere down the line.”

Your Back Arm Is a Stabilizer, Not an Afterthought

Bend your back arm to roughly 90 degrees and keep your elbow away from your body. That single adjustment fixes more posture problems than any other single tweak a beginner can make.

Surfer's back arm bent at 90 degrees for stability

Here’s why the bend matters. A straight or dangling back arm collapses your chest inward, which pulls your shoulders down and forward. Surfers call the resulting posture the “pooh stance,” a hunched, low-chested crouch that looks like you’re bracing for impact rather than riding a wave. Bending the back arm at roughly 90 degrees opens the chest back up and pulls your shoulders into a position where they can actually rotate freely instead of fighting your own posture.

Beyond posture, the back arm does real functional work:

  • It acts as a counterweight during turns, especially sharp ones where your lead arm is extended hard toward the target.
  • Small adjustments in the back arm’s angle help you fine-tune rotation without overcorrecting with your hips.
  • Keeping the elbow up and away from your ribs gives you a faster reaction if you need to brace during a wipeout.

If you catch yourself hunching, the fix is almost embarrassingly simple: bend the elbow, pull it slightly back and away from your body, and feel your chest open. Do this as a mid-wave micro-correction, not just something you fix between waves. The best surfers make this adjustment without thinking about it because they trained it into a reflex early, usually through the exact kind of repetition drills covered in the practice routine below.

Common Arm Mistakes Beginners Make (And Quick Fixes)

Most beginner arm problems fall into a short, predictable list. Once you know what to look for, they’re fast to correct.

  • Arms drifting over the toe rail. This pulls your weight forward and down, which stalls the board or buries the nose. Fix: keep both arms inside your body’s width, not reaching past the rail.
  • Floppy, disconnected arms. Arms that hang loose or flail during a turn send no signal to the board at all. Fix: exaggerate the pointing motion until it feels almost silly. Dial it back once it’s automatic.
  • Crossing arms during a turn. Beginners often let the back arm swing across the body when the lead arm reaches for a sharp turn. Fix: keep the back arm bent and stationary, moving only in small increments, while the lead arm does the reaching.
  • Looking down at the board instead of the target. Your eyes anchor the whole chain. Look down and your arms, shoulders, and hips have nothing to aim at. Fix: pick a fixed point on shore before every wave and keep your eyes there through the turn.

Fixing any of these usually comes down to one of a few reliable methods. Exaggeration drills on land, the same ones used to teach the lead arm, work just as well for correcting floppy or crossed arms. Filming yourself, even on a phone propped on the beach, shows you exactly what your arms are doing in ways you can’t feel in the moment. A friend or instructor watching from shore can call out corrections in real time, and coaching feedback consistently speeds up motor learning compared to guessing alone. And if you’re overwhelmed trying to fix everything at once, simplify. Focus only on the lead arm for a full session, then only on the back arm the next. Trying to fix four habits simultaneously usually fixes none of them.

A 30-Minute Practice Routine to Build Arm Memory

You don’t need hours to make this stick. You need focus and repetition, structured the right way.

Here’s a session that works whether you’re practicing on a beach in Waikiki or a quiet stretch of coastline anywhere else:

  1. Warm up and observe (10 minutes). Sit on the sand and watch the waves before you paddle out. Note where they break, how fast they move, and where a rider would naturally point their lead arm on a typical ride. Surf Science recommends this kind of observation period specifically because it lets you visualize your arm placement and turn timing before you’re under pressure in the water.
  2. Dry-land drills (15 minutes). Run through pop-up repetitions with lead-arm pointing, alternating with target-vision drills where you snap your eyes and arm to a fixed object. Do at least 15 to 20 reps of each.
  3. Whitewater repetition (5 to 10 minutes). Take the same cues into small, forgiving whitewater. Focus only on pointing and looking, not on speed or style.
  4. Five focused green-wave attempts. Once whitewater feels automatic, take five attempts on slightly larger, unbroken waves. Apply the same lead-arm and back-arm cues you just drilled.

Measuring progress doesn’t require a stopwatch or a scorecard. Watch for three signs instead: pop-ups that feel stable rather than wobbly, turns that happen earlier and smoother instead of late and jerky, and noticeably less arm flailing when you catch a wave. Efficient paddling and a stable pop-up are what make the arm cues possible in the first place. If your pop-up is still shaky, spend extra time there before worrying about arm precision. How Arm Position Changes Your Paddling Speed

Everything you do with your arms before you stand up sets up everything you do with them once you’re riding.

Paddling efficiently means alternating long, steady strokes while keeping your chest up and your lower back slightly arched. This posture matters for a reason beginners rarely connect to arm positioning: the same shoulder and chest openness that makes for good paddling technique is exactly the posture that sets up a clean pop-up into a proper lead-arm and back-arm stance. Paddle hunched with your chest down, and you’ll pop up hunched too, right into the “pooh stance” that collapses your back arm’s angle before you’ve even caught the wave.

Sloppy, splashy strokes waste energy you’ll need for the pop-up itself. Beginners who paddle with short, choppy strokes often arrive at their pop-up already fatigued, which means the arms go wherever gravity and panic take them rather than where the turn requires. Steady, full strokes conserve enough energy that your arms have something left to work with the moment you’re on your feet.

There’s a timing element too. Paddling faster into a wave gives you an extra half second at the top of your pop-up to find your target and get your lead arm oriented before the wave’s energy takes over. That extra half second is often the difference between a controlled first turn and a scramble to catch up with a board that’s already decided its own direction.

Adjusting Your Arms for Different Wave Types

The 90-degree back arm and pointed lead arm are your defaults, but conditions change how much you rely on them.

In small, mushy whitewater, exaggerate everything. Slower-moving water gives you more time to correct, so lean into wide, obvious arm movements while you’re still building the habit. As waves get steeper or faster, particularly on a greener, unbroken face, your movements need to shrink and sharpen. A wide, slow arm swing on a fast-breaking wave arrives too late to matter. Aim for smaller, quicker adjustments that still hit the same target, just with less exaggeration and more precision.

Choppy or crumbly waves demand a slightly lower back-arm position for extra stability, since the surface underneath you is less predictable. Clean, glassy conditions let you extend both arms a bit further out, since balance is easier to hold and a fuller extension gives you a stronger steering signal. Longer, gentler rolling waves, the kind beginners usually start on, reward patience: hold your lead-arm point longer before initiating the turn, since the wave gives you more runway to work with. Beginner Arms vs. Pro Arms: What Actually Changes

Watch a professional surfer and a first-week beginner side by side, and the arm mechanics look almost unrecognizable, even though the underlying principle is identical.

Diagram comparing beginner and pro surfer arm positioning and timing

Beginners need big, deliberate signals. The exaggerated pointing drills covered earlier exist because a beginner’s body hasn’t yet built the automatic link between eyes, arm, and hip rotation. Every motion has to be conscious and oversized to register at all.

Professional surfers have compressed that same signal into something almost invisible. Their lead arm might extend only a few inches, or barely lift, yet it still carries the same rotational intent because years of repetition turned a conscious motor pattern into a reflex. Where a beginner’s back arm sits locked at a fixed 90-degree angle for stability, a pro’s back arm makes constant tiny adjustments, functioning more like a rudder making micro-corrections than a static brace.

The other real difference is timing. Beginners tend to move their arms after their hips start turning, playing catch-up. Pros move the arm first, sometimes by a fraction of a second, and let the rest of the body follow. That sequencing, arm before hips, is largely what separates a smooth, early turn from a late, jerky one. It’s also exactly what the exaggerated pointing drills are training you to build, just at beginner speed instead of pro speed.

What Beginners Get Wrong About Arm Cues

Most beginner advice treats arm positioning as a footnote to stance and pop-up mechanics. That’s backwards. The arms are the signal that makes stance and pop-up mechanics mean anything at all.

The conventional wisdom leans hard on stance width and foot placement, and those matter, but a beginner with perfect footwork and dead arms will still turn late and lose balance. What gets underestimated is how much a single pointed arm simplifies everything else. You stop thinking about six separate body parts and start thinking about one: where does the arm point? Everything else, the hip rotation, the shoulder turn, even the eventual pop-up timing, organizes itself around that one decision.

If you take one thing from this article, prioritize the lead-arm drill over every other technique tip you’ve read. Footwork adjustments and balance tricks matter eventually. But the fastest path from flailing to flowing is a beginner who has drilled “point and look” until it’s reflex, on land, before ever paddling into whitewater. Everything else builds on that.

Frequently Asked Questions

Where exactly should my lead arm point while surfing?
Point it toward the direction you want the board to travel, roughly in line with your front foot, extended with a slight elbow bend rather than locked straight.

How bent should my back arm be?
Aim for roughly 90 degrees. This keeps your chest open, prevents hunching, and gives you a stable counterweight through turns.

Why does looking where I want to go help my arm positioning?
Your eyes, arm, and hip rotation work as one connected system. Looking at your target first helps your lead arm and torso rotate in the same direction automatically instead of fighting each other.

How long does it take to fix bad arm habits as a beginner?
It varies by how much you practice, but exaggerated land drills combined with immediate feedback, from video or an instructor, tend to correct habits faster than unguided water time alone.

Should I focus on my lead arm or back arm first?
Start with the lead arm since it drives direction and turning. Once pointing feels automatic, shift focus to the back arm’s bend and stability role.
